DNS Issues and How to Resolve Them
DNS (Domain Name System) issues can prevent users from accessing HDHub4U. This problem occurs when the website's domain name fails to resolve to its corresponding IP address. To resolve DNS issues, users can try the following steps:
- Clear the DNS cache on their device.
- Switch to a public DNS service like Google DNS or Cloudflare DNS.
- Restart their router or modem.
If these steps don't work, the issue might be related to other factors, such as server downtime or ISP blocks.

Firewall Blocks and ISP Restrictions
Internet service providers (ISPs) often block access to unauthorized streaming platforms like HDHub4U to comply with legal requirements or protect users from potential security risks. These blocks can manifest as firewalls or DNS restrictions, making it difficult for users to access the site.
Some users attempt to bypass these restrictions using virtual private networks (VPNs) or proxy services. However, it's important to note that using such methods may violate ISP policies or local laws.
